Managing Population Rule Sets

Managing Population Rule Sets

A Population rule-set is a file used by the SSA-NAME3 callable routine to modify its behavior for different countries, languages or data populations.
Population rule-sets may be one of three types:
  • Standard Populations are provided with the product.
  • A Custom Population may be built by an Informatica Corporation consultant for a customer with unusual or special needs.
  • A Local Population is the result of local rules modifications done via the Population Override Manager or Edit RuleWizard.
It is possible for a system to have all three types of Population rule-sets. If so, there is an order of precedence in loading by SSA-NAME3. If a Local Population (file extension of
.YLP
) is present in the folder identified by the "System" Control, it is loaded; else if a Custom Population is present (file extension of
.YCP
), it is loaded; else the Standard Population is loaded (file extension of
.YSP
).
